That clean glass. Haha I have one of these and love it, but I find that the fire burns very sooty and the buildup can fall down from ceiling onto the pizza. Also the wood gas can give a bad flavor to the pizza depending on the wood (mesquite particularly). Oak and eucalyptus work well. I've thought about adding some air pipes to give it secondary air. I'm not sure how well it work work, but it could be great?? I find that hanging the door on the top hook but leaving the hinges outside of their slots gives some extra air in from the gap in the bottom that helps, but still keeps any wind from blowing the flames out the back of the firebox. Also the door thermometer is a joke. I only use an infrared thermometer on the stone before I set the new pizza in (between 600-700F is best IME), and then let the fire rip.
